Educators … WebReading and Writing (Literacy) [ en Español] Literacy is your ability to read and write. These skills are important for school, at work, and at home. Speech-language pathologists, or SLPs, can help you learn to read and write. You start to learn language as a baby. You learn how to say sounds and put them together to make words. shvi vein clinic ballantyne

Everyone always talks about how ... thepartsbox420Web22 sep. 2024 · Speech sound disorders can have a negative impact on a person’s ability to communicate effectively. Individuals with speech sound disorders may have difficulty producing certain sounds correctly, which can make it difficult for others to understand them.
